Welcome to Honors at City
The two college-wide honors programs at City College (the Macaulay Honors College at The City College and the City College Honors Program) prepare eager, exceptional and imaginative students (mostly incoming freshmen) for a lifetime of learning. The heart of each program is a challenging general education curriculum with small classes taught by our best faculty.  Students receive individualized student services and access to exciting opportunities for internships and undergraduate research.

The Honors Center, a suite on the fourth floor of the NAC Building (Room 4/150), provides a place for honors students to study and meet in a supportive atmosphere, where the Honors staff is available to advise and assist.

The City College honors community fosters serious study, extracurricular engagement and civic responsibility, while not losing sight of the value of fun.
